Replicating Reality

As humans, we have continually striven to replicate and create reality. Think about all the video games so far. The ones that started as a block of pixels have now advanced to the graphics level, where they appear photorealistic. We are continually chasing a perfect replication of reality in video games. The same applies to ‘digital arts.’ Indeed, there are many different branches, but all the advanced software and tools focus on bringing the most realistic results possible for the artists. We get inspiration from reality, after all. Whether it is drawing a tree, a firetruck, or something else, all exist in the physical realms, and that’s why we can imagine drawing it.

Manipulating Reality In Photographs

Almost every artist and photographer has heard of the photoshop tool. What was its purpose? To become a versatile photo editing tool. It was then used for photoshoots of the models to tweak their features, makeup and more. Indeed, makeup could only do so much; they had to rely on photoshop for editing. At first, it was all about capturing reality, but with continually advancing tools. We also started using our creative sides to edit and enhance the photographs. This led to many abstract concepts, as well.

Photography As A Base Of Creation

Today, when we want to draw something, like a world, or a scene, we take references from the photograph. Even if you want to draw a human being or a creature, you need photographs to show you the details. The visuals, even if in digital format, are all photographs. We are also rapidly moving towards AI tools. The tools that can change your portrait into scenery or more. This advancement, while astonishing, still uses photographs as a baseline to do anything. This shows that photographs, in any format, have become the backbone of the rising digital arts.

Revamp – Photography’s Association With Creativity

Once upon a time – Photography was just about capturing the moments taking place in reality. Two personalities, like presidents meeting together, would be captured in the photograph as an evergreen moment. Later, it became available to the masses, and people started capturing all sorts of moments. Then came the individuals with a visionary approach. They saw the beauty in nature, real life, portraits, and more. Hence, we received photography as an art form that everyone could enjoy. These people could see the beauty in the mundane reality and, with editing tools, could enhance it further to look fantastic. And now, we have high-end editing tools that enable photographers to manipulate their pictures and generate new art forms. This transcends to the Digital Arts.
